The Ogun State Civil Service Commission has announced plans to conduct a Computer-Based Test (CBT) for applicants seeking employment into the Ogun State Traffic Compliance and Enforcement Agency (TRACE).
According to a statement signed by the Permanent Secretary of the Commission, Mr. Adesoji Adewuyi, the examination for prospective Traffic Compliance Officers will hold on Thursday, May 14, 2026, at the Federal University of Agriculture, Abeokuta (FUNAAB), Alabata.
The statement noted that the exercise would take place at the 500-Seater Auditorium, ICT Centre, beginning at 10:00 a.m.
Applicants who successfully completed and submitted their recruitment forms were directed to collect their examination identity cards at the Conference Room of the Civil Service Commission from Monday, May 11, 2026.
The commission further advised candidates to come to the examination venue with only their identity cards, stressing that mobile phones and other electronic devices would not be permitted in the examination hall.
Candidates were also urged to arrive early and be seated by 8:00 a.m. ahead of the commencement of the test.
The commission reaffirmed its commitment to a transparent and credible recruitment process for qualified applicants into the state traffic management agency.
